A process for polymerizing ethylene to form branched low-pressure polyethylene having a main chain and side chains of different lengths, the side chains having lengths of 14-200 carbon atoms, which comprises reacting ethylene in the presence of a catalyst at a pressure of 1-1000 bar and at a temperature of 20-200 degrees C, the catalyst comprising a preformed bifunctional catalyst obtained by bonding in an inert reaction medium:
- i. a first catalyst comprising a chromium compound on a silica or aluminum oxide support, wherein the quantity of chromium compound, based on the quantity of the support, is from 0.1 to 3.5% by weight, the chromium compound being in the form of a coordinatively unsaturated chromium (II) and/or chromium (III) compound which is obtained by treating the support with an aqueous solution of a chromium (VI) compound, separating the solution from the impregnated support, drying the impregnated support and heating it at temperatures above 500.degree. C. in an oxygen stream for 1/2 to 3 hours and subsequently reducing the chromium (VI) compound with a gaseous reducing agent at 250.degree. to 500.degree. C. to yield a coordinatively unsaturated chromium (II) compound; with
- ii) a second catalyst comprising a nickel compound selected from the group consisting of:
- a) a nickel compound produced by reaction of a nickel (O) compound, or a nickel compound which can be converted into a nickel (O) compound in situ, with an adduct or a mixture of a quinoid compound and a tertiary phosphine and with a compound of the formula (I) ##STR5## in which R.sup.1, R.sup.2 and R.sup.3 , independently of one another, denote optionally halogen-, hydroxyl-, C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koxy-, nitro- or C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ryloxy-substituted C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l, C.sub.2 -C.sub.20 -alkenyl, C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l or C.sub.3 -C.sub.8 -cycloalkyl, or denote C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l-C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l, C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l-C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l, C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l-C.sub.2 -C.sub.20 -alkenyl, C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l-C.sub.3 -C.sub.8 -cycloalkyl and C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l-C.sub.3 -C.sub.8 -cycloalkyl, di-C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 -alkylamino, phenoxy, or alkoxy,
- X denotes 0, NR.sup.4 or ##STR6## R.sup.4, R.sup.5 and R.sup.6, independently of one another, denote hydrogen, acyl, silyl, halogen, cyano, nitrophenyl or R.sup.1 and
- n denotes zero or 1;
- and
- b) a nickel compound obtained by reacting a nickel (O) compound or a compound which can be converted into a nickel (O) compound in situ with compounds of the formulae (I) as defined above and (III) ##STR7## in which R.sup.10 -R.sup.14 represent, independently of one another, optionally halogen-, hydroxyl, C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koxy-, or C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ryloxy-substituted C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l, C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l, C.sub.2 -C.sub.30 -alkenyl or C.sub.3 -C.sub.8 -cycloalkyl, C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l-C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l, C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kyl-C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ryl, halogen, hydroxyl, C.sub.1 -C.sub.20 -alkoxy, or C.sub.6 -C.sub.12 -aryloxy, in addition to which R.sup.13 may be hydrogen, and
- R.sup.14 may be hydrogen, acyl or sulphonate.
